The half life of a first order reaction is `100` seconds at `280` K. If the temperature coefficient is `3.0` its rate constant at `290` K in `s^(-1)` is

A

`2.08xx10^(-3)`

B

`2.08xx10^(-2)`

C

`6.93xx10^(-3)`

D

`6.93xx10^(-2)`

Text Solution

Verified by Experts

The correct Answer is:
B
